Hi,

I have a 2021 Powerwagon. I had a Magnaflow muffler installed in place of the factory and a performance resonator in place of the factory. I get a loud drone between 1600 and 1900 rpms. Has anyone else experienced this and suggest a fix?

Muffler shop suggesting going back to either factory resonator with magnaflow muffler, factory muffler with performance resonator or trying to weld in a j pipe to reduce the drone.

Any help would be appreciated.

Didn't you modify the exhaust so it would make noise? Now it's making noise.
 
Get that with a lot of after market exhaust. Does it exit in the rear like factory?
 
Go back and tell them to install a Hienz-Holt filter pipe tuned to the exhsust.
Some call it a J pipe. Its basically a frequency filter that cancels out the drone.
They use them in factory air intakes as well.
 
J pipe. Magna flows seem to drone at that RPM. Had the same issue on a V6 car. Magna flow used my car to prototype a exhaust for it. When I told them about the drone, they just shrugged it off. I had them ship my stock exhaust to me. I reinstalled it and sold the prototype.
 
I went back to factory muffler and deleted the resonator. Not nearly as aggressive, but no drone.
The drone with Magnaflow was bad in the above mentioned RPM range. Most of my cruising is in that range.
